ADHD is a neurological condition that can impact many aspects of one’s life including impulse control, organization, time management and more. Go deeper into specific ADHD-related topics with this resource collection offering support and information for families and individuals dealing with ADHD.

Learning differences is a broad term that can encompass many aspects of how we learn. Discover more about learning differences, including signs and symptoms, strategies for addressing learning challenges, and links to additional resources for managing learning differences effectively.
